The Impact you will have in this role:
As a member of the Enterprise Client Operations team, the Training Associate is responsible for ensuring that DTCC's clients are educated on how to maximize their use of DTCC's products and services. A deep knowledge of DTCC's products and the industry enables the Training Associate to deliver training that is customized to the needs of each client, facilitating both the onboarding experience of new clients and their continuous learning.
